Well I remember the Pigs Rubbing their backs on our old Ford Eight, And skidding on polished floor, upstairs, Whenever they squeezed through the gate. In the quiet of The Evening With Baby at Mothers breast, The Mice, with stuttering walk, And noses held at angle best, Gave to us delicious delight, Carrying off a crumb or two, Towards their hidden nest. Here we saw a friendly Ghost Standing at the foot of the bed, And many a time the old rooks nest Tumbled on our head Blocking the chimney, returning the smoke, Making our eyes rimmed red. Across the road, a giant hangar, An Air Force Store no more, And further on, a Burial Mound, The survivor of many a War. And over there By The Cross, and The Horse, Beyond The Roman Way, Another Oldbury paints The Horizon, Survives another day. Yatesbury, Wiltshire, 1957. |
